Users have found that flying from Bristol to Paris on a Thursday typically leans towards higher prices. However, this doesn’t mean you still can’t find a deal. Flexibility with other aspects of your flight can still land a great price for your trip.
To save up to 71% on this flight, we recommend booking at least 53 days prior to travel. The price may fluctuate and will likely increase closer to your departure date. Users on Cheapflights have found tickets from Bristol to Paris from £102 1-2 weeks out and tickets from £143 for flights departing within the next 72 hours.
Due to multiple factors, expect to potentially pay more when booking in December. For low rates, January can be a great choice for travel to Paris. Flights to Paris from Bristol in January are about £100 on average during January, but can be found for as low as £52.
One of the essential ways to save on airfare from Bristol to Paris is to remain as flexible as possible. Flights that are in the morning tend to be the most expensive. A flight in the evening could potentially save you up to 21% on airfare.

For a flight from Bristol to Paris, you will be flying from Bristol. Bristol (BRS) is just 7.4 mi from the center of the city. Bristol is the only Bristol airport and it handles 2 outbound flights to Paris per day. 3 airlines have flights to Paris from Bristol on a regular basis.

There are many flights that can get you from Bristol to Paris in 1h 20m. Fly via easyJet or Ryanair to get the fastest option. There are 285 mi between Bristol and Paris. When browsing for deals, the options you’ll see will be for both direct flights and flights with stops.
